How do radio waves behave and why is it important when building a public WiFi network to understand their behavior? We'll talk about wave phenomena like reflection, refraction, diffraction, absorption, and refraction! You'll be surprised at how light, sound, and ocean waves behave so similarly and how we can harness these waves to carry data for us!

The goal of this series of talks is to inspire and educate residents and neighbors of the Hill District, enabling them to build their own public WiFi network along Centre Avenue. The lessons learned at this and other classes in the series will be instrumental in building a strong public WiFi network. All classes will be held at the Hill House First Source Center.
